Why user assistance is important in digital gaming
User faith forms the foundation of successful gaming ventures. Players put actual cash into accounts, expecting safe transfers and just treatment. When problems arise, responsive support reassures customers that the operator appreciates their business. Poor support damages image rapidly, as dissatisfied players spread bad incidents through reviews and discussions.

Support services typically feature several communication options: real-time messaging, electronic mail, telephone hotlines, and self-service resources. Each channel serves particular objectives and accommodates to various player preferences. Some players choose fast resolutions through chat, while others need detailed written explanations.
Digital mail acts as the favored channel for complex questions requiring comprehensive clarifications or records. Players use email when submitting identity documents, disputing payments, or seeking account log. This channel permits customers to attach images, bank documents, and identity documents. Representatives can examine information carefully before delivering detailed answers.

Account setup represents the primary engagement between users and support systems. New players meet queries about enrollment conditions, accepted identification files, and registration procedures. Support teams guide registrants through form completion, explain compulsory fields, and explain age requirements. Precise direction during signup establishes positive initial experiences.
Identity verification safeguards both providers and users from deception and regulatory infractions. Platforms require official ID, verification of address, and payment option verification. Users commonly require help understanding which files are acceptable, how to submit clear images, and why verification holdups happen. Agents explain security measures to comfort anxious users.

Regulatory adherence obliges platforms to maintain accessible customer service. Licensing authorities mandate specific response durations and communication benchmarks. Operators must document exchanges, settle issues justly, and provide transparent information. Neglect to meet these responsibilities can result in penalties or license suspension.
Competitive sectors drive platforms to stand out through service quality. Players pick operators that offer trustworthy help alongside attractive promotions.
